Frequently asked

About Expert Dossiers

Does a medical degree make every public claim true?
Credentials establish professional training; they do not auto-validate speculative physics analogies, n=1 protocols, or absolute diet claims. We grade claims against trials, guidelines, and toxicology dose bridges independently of halo effects.
Why cover influencers at all?
Because readers already encounter them. Mapping claims to grades reduces harm from both uncritical adoption and uncritical dismissal of useful hygiene practices buried inside larger frameworks.
Are these endorsements?
No. Dossiers are analytical. We may endorse specific practices (morning outdoor light, progressive overload) while rejecting absolute packaging of those practices into unproven totalizing systems.
